Reinforced Concrete Design to EuroCode 2
By W.H. Mosley, R. Hulse, and J.H Bungey
December 1996
McMillan UK
ISBN: 033360878X
426 pages, illustrated
$67.50 paper original
This text has been developed from the widely known and established textbook Reinforced Concrete Design. It adopts the same form of presentation to cover the design and detailing of reinforced and prestressed concrete members and structures to the new EuroCode for the design of concrete structures. Appropriate design charts, tables, and formula are included as design aids and, for ease of reference, an appendix contains a summary of important design equations with design tables and charts. Suitable for undergraduate courses in structural concrete, and for practicing engineers seeking information on the implementation of EC2.Contents:
Preface Properties of Reinforced Concrete Limit State Design Analysis of the Structure Analysis of the Section Shear, Bond and Torsion Serviceability, Durability and Stability Design of RC Beams Design of RC Slabs Column Design Foundations Water-retaining Structures and Retaining Walls Prestressed Concrete Composite Construction
Author Biographies:
W. H. MOSLEY is formerly Senior Teaching Fellow at Nanyang Technological Institution, Singapore. RAY HULSE is Associate Dean, School of the Built Environment, Coventry University. J. H. BUNGEY is Head of the Structures Group and Professor of Civil Engineering, University of Liverpool.
